Ingredients
Scale
1.5 cups all-purpose flour
1 tsp baking soda
0.5 tsp baking powder
0.25 tsp salt
0.5 cups unsalted butter, softened
1 cup granulated sugar
2 large eggs
3 ripe bananas, mashed
1 tsp vanilla extract
0.5 cups sour cream
8 oz cream cheese, softened
0.25 cups unsalted butter, softened
2 cups powdered sugar
1 tsp vanilla extract
Instructions
Start by gathering all the ingredients.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C) and grease and flour a 9-inch round cake pan.
In a medium bowl, whisk together the flour, baking soda, baking powder, and salt. Set this dry mixture aside.
Cream together the softened unsalted butter and granulated sugar until light and fluffy.
Beat in the eggs, one at a time. Mix in the mashed bananas and vanilla extract until well combined.
Add the sour cream to the banana mixture and mix just until blended.
Gradually add the dry flour mixture to the banana mixture, stirring gently until combined.
Pour the batter into the prepared cake pan and bake for 25-30 minutes or until a toothpick comes out clean.
Allow the cake to cool in the pan for about 10 minutes before transferring it to a wire rack.
While the cake cools, prepare the cream cheese frosting by beating together the cream cheese and butter until creamy. Gradually add the powdered sugar and vanilla extract.
Once the cake has cooled, spread the cream cheese frosting over the top and sides.
Slice the cake and serve at room temperature.
Notes
Ensure bananas are very ripe for the best flavor. Customize with spices or nuts if desired.
